首先先说明一下,Microsoft 在 2005 年底将 Internet Explorer 改成了 Windows Internet Explorer,它的意思也就是说,从 Vista 开始,Internet Explorer(IE)将正式完完全全地做为 Windows 的组件。所以,现在还在测试期的 Windows Internet Explorer 7 Beta 2 Preview 这个名称上会有 Windows,也就是因为这个。
安装 Windows Internet Explorer 7
Microsoft 在 2006 年 2 月 1 日以全用户测试的方式公开了 Windows Internet Explorer 7 Beta 2 Preview(以下简称 WIE7),但是这个并不是第一个版本的 Beta 2。参与内测的 WIE7 在之前就已经拿到了更早的 Build 版本。
x1pmAkndzHuOfcCkFS9U9fwJ86vJ2KYBofZuibIk5BydPwnexrIm1_p7M1AbuzvAWNmXHzITDwDoe2PZbNYT9v9Hl4CFx-HmhomDUoy7Z9tDS4H0rjgSJ8jcl3c6IY272GO
(图1 Windows Internet Explorer 7 Beta 2 Preview 主界面)
现在公开测试的 WIE7 仍然只有英文版本,相比 WIE7 Beta 1,安装程序已经完成了,在 Beta 1 时,Microsoft 提供的还只是一个 Windows Update 的方式。
x1pmAkndzHuOfcCkFS9U9fwJ_-aRqeeI6FBv46C1pXVIFlinFKPhg56kJj43ZDngxZDLVOfY7h05e8LrK0qck3ukEsAKvPeO12OyN0p4rj0zMjjbkn0U99cntEbO7bCTQNkRQPpxRSSEvk

历过了三天时间……当然不是 72 小时了。完成了《SD高达G世纪NEO》的 PSF2 的 RIP,好大……压成固实的 RAR 包都有 39.8M,100 个全 BGM……
接下来准备把 WIE7B2P 的东西写出来,接着继续玩 RIP……我承认,这东西好玩……

希望这篇文章能够对 IE 用户有所帮助,其内容都是根据本人的使用经验和在新闻组中遇到的用户所反馈的问题分析整理而成(部分内容整理自微软 Windows 创新日课件),所以难免有疏漏之处,欢迎各位加以补充。
原作者:Steven Li
一般来说 Internet Explorer 浏览器自身出现故障的情况比较少,大多数故障都是因为系统中存在的流氓软件和第三方控件(ActiveX)、浏览器帮助程序对象(BHO)所造成的。恶意广告软件(Adware)、间谍软件(Spyware)、恶意共享软件(Malicious shareware)都属于流氓软件的范畴。此类程序通常都有一个共同的特点,那就是在用户毫不知情的情况下被安装到系统中,不易被察觉且不能被轻易找到和卸载,甚至根本就没有提供卸载程序,它们不但会使 IE 或系统出现各种莫名奇妙的故障,更令人深恶痛绝的是还会偷偷记录用户的操作记录和使用习惯并将其发送到相关厂商或个人(也就是指我们常说的行为记录),从而造成用户隐私被泄漏。所以,建议大家使用工具将它们从系统中“请出去”,推荐使用以下几款反间谍软件查杀(建议断网后在安全模式中扫描系统):
1、HiJackThis
下载地址:http://www.hijackthis.de/en
2、Windows AntiSpyware(Windows Defender)
下载地址:http://www.microsoft.com/athome/ … ftware/default.mspx
3、CWShredder
下载地址:http://www.trendmicro.com/cwshredder/
4、Ad-Aware
下载地址:http://www.lavasoft.de/ms/index.htm
5、eTrust PestPatrol Anti-Spyware
下载地址:http://www.ca.com/products/pestpatrol
6、Spybot Search and Destroy
下载地址:http://www.safer-networking.org/microsoft.en.html
关于 Microsoft Windows Antispyware 工具,要在这里说明一下,可能很少人用到该程序自带的辅助工具,您通过单击主界面右上角的“Advanced Tools”选项就可以进入该程序自带的三个辅助工具页面,其中有 system explorers、Browser Restore、Tracks Eraser
[System Explorers]中的“Browser Helper Objects(BHO)”可以检测到 IE 浏览器中所安装插件,并可以用图释来反映该插件是安全的还是危险的,您可以根据提示来阻止第三方插件或将其删除掉。
[Browser Restore]可以帮助您恢复被恶意劫持的浏览器,您只需在其列表中选中恶意网页后并单击“Restore”按钮即可将被劫持的浏览器恢复到正常状态。
[Tracks Eraser]则可以帮助您清除掉所有的系统操作记录,这样可以保护您的个人稳私不被泄漏,要知道流氓软件的手段之一就是偷偷记录下用户的操作记录然后发送给相关厂商或个人,也就是我们常说的行为记录,这种行为非常恶劣,当打开“Tracks Eraser”项后可以看到一个操作列表清单,您可以选择想要清除的操作记录然后单击“Erase Tracks”按钮即可。
相关信息您可以参考以下知识库文章:
微软官方网站中关于间谍软件信息的页面 http://www.microsoft.com/china/a … pyware/default.mspx
怎样对付间谍软件和其他有害的软件 http://www.microsoft.com/china/a … re/spywarewhat.mspx
帮助识别欺骗性(冒牌)网站和恶意超链接及进行自我防护的步骤 http://support.microsoft.com/default.aspx?scid=kb;[ln];833786&spid=807&sid=global
访问某些Web站点时显示新窗口 http://support.microsoft.com/def … =807&sid=global
欺骗性软件可能会使计算机出现莫名其妙的问题 http://support.microsoft.com/default.aspx?scid=kb;zh-cn;827315
主页设置被意外更改或者无法更改主页设置 http://support.microsoft.com/def … =807&sid=global
安装SP2后及更新了最新补丁以后Internet Explorer常见的一些问题
当您的系统安装了 XP SP2 补“后,Internet Explorer 也随之更新为 SP2,并且其安全性有所提升,IE6 SP2 在安全方面主要有以下特性:
1、锁定本机域(Local Machine Zone) 2、更加严格的 Binary Behavior 控制 3、默认不允许区域提升 4、默认会阻止没有经过签名的 ActiveX Controls 5、严格的MIME信息检查 6、默认会阻止弹出窗口
案例一:Windows XP SP2系统中IE不能正确显示网页内容
故障现象:当用户点击一些文件的链接时,比如一个视频文件(WMV)或者一个图片文件(JPG),IE并没有提示下载框,有的时候甚至将这些文件显示成纯文本的状态,从用户的角度去看,就是显示成乱码。
故障原因:WEB 管理员设置了错误的 Content-Type,IE 在 SP2 中进行了更加严格的 MIME 检查,如果 IE 发现 Server 所指定的 Content-Type 与扩展名以及 MIME Sniff 的结果不符合时,那么 IE 就会拒绝下载文件。
解决方案:需要修改服务器页面上的Content-Type或者通过修改客户端注册表来弱化IE的MIME检查(不推荐)。
案例二:安装最新补丁以后所有包含 ActiveX 的网页工作不正常
1、故障现象:安装 MS05-052 补丁后,很多包含 ActiveX 的网页工作不正常。
故障原因:因为 MS05-052 补丁加强了 IE 的安全性,它引入了更多的安全检查,其中一项就是在 COM 对象可以在 IE 中运行之前,IE 会检查 ObjectSafey 接口中是否存在位于 Internet 区域的 ActiveX 控件,这个新功能很大程度上保护了客户端的安全。
解决方案:要想从根本上解决该问题,您需要对 ActiveX 重新编译,并将控件标识为安全。相关方法您可以参考以下两篇知识库文章: http://support.microsoft.com/kb/216434 http://support.microsoft.com/kb/161873
临时解决方案:可以通过添加注册表方式将 ActiveX 控件标记为可安全执行脚本和可安全初始化,相关信息您可以参考以下知识库文章: http://support.microsoft.com/kb/909738
2、故障现象:安装了 MS05-051 以后,出现下列症状:
– Windows 安装程序、Windows 防火墙、COM+ 服务可能不会启动 – 网络连接文件夹为空 – Windows 更新网站可能会错误的建议您更改 IE 中的“持续使用用户数据”设置 – 在 IIS 上运行的 ActiveX Server Pages(ASP) 页返回“HTTP 500”信息 – Microsoft 组件服务 Microsoft 管理控制台(MMC)树中的“计算机”节点无法展开 – 经过身份验证的用户无法登陆,而且在用户应用十月份的安全更新后出现空白屏幕
故障原因:如果有任何 COM/COM+ 应用程序无法访问 COM+ 编录文件(%Windir%registration*.CLB)就可能会出现此问题,应用程序不能访问 COM+ 编录文件是因为这些文件上的权限巳被更改,不再是原来的默认设置,在安装 MS05-051 补丁之前,不要求提供对 COM+ 编录的显示权限,但安装后会检查权限。
解决方案:请确保 Admin、System 对 %Windir%registration 有完全控制权限,并确保 Everyone 对 %Windir%registration 有读权限。
Internet Explorer 的常规排错步骤
步骤一:如果是IE本身出现错误,其原因多数都是因为某些属于IE的DLL、OCX组件注册不正确或是在注册表中的注册信息产生混乱、损坏、丢失造成的,您可以按如下几种方法重新注册IE的组件:
方法一:在“开始,“运行”中输入:““%Program Files%Internet Exploreriexplore.exe” /rereg”(包含加粗的引号) 后点击确定即可。
方法二;打开记事本输入以下内容:
For %% i in (c:windowssystem32*.dll) Do regsvr32.exe /s %%i For %% i in (c:windowssystem32*.ocx) Do regsvr32.exe /s %%i
然后将其保存为 reg.bat 批处理文件,运行它就可以修复一些因动态链接库失效所造成的问题。
方法三:请逐个重新注册以下列出的与IE有关的重要DLL(动态链接库)文件:
scrrun.dll msxml.dll mshtml.dll jscript.dll Urlmon.dll shdocvw.dll browseui.dll softpub.dll wintrust.dll dssenh.dll rsaenh.dll gpkcsp.dll sccbase.dll slbcsp.dll cryptdlg.dll actxprxy.dll shell32.dll oleaut32.dll
注册方法:在“开始”,“运行”中键入“regsvr32 DLL 文件名
注意: regsvr32 命令与 DLL 文件之间有空格且注册时不包括引号
如果注册时发现某个文件找不到,那么您可以从 http://www.dll-files.com 搜索下载该文件并将其复制到系统盘的 windows/system32 文件夹中然后再尝试注册该文件即可。
步骤二:清除所有的 IE 缓存文件、COOKIE、历史记录、自动完成表单和密码、SSL 状态
进入 IE 中的“Internet 选项”“常规”页面并“清除历史记录”、“删除 Cookies”、“删除文件”—“删除所有脱机内容”。
进入 IE 中的“Internet 选项”“隐私”页面检查级别是否被设置过高,如果是请降低级别为中或更低。
进入 IE 中的“Internet 选项”“内容”选项点击“清空 SSL 状态”并进入“自动完成”选项,点击“清除表单”“清除密码”确定后退出。
您也可以到以下地址下载一款名为“ClearIECache”的工具来删除所有的 IE 缓存文件、COOKIE、历史记录: http://www.microsoft.com/downloa … &displaylang=en
步骤三:请将 Internet Explorer 中的所有设置重新设为默认设置。
步骤四:禁用或删除第三方控件
如果您的系统为 XP SP2,那么可以通过 IE 中的“管理加载项”功能禁用它们,如果为其它系统则可以通过取消选中“Internet 选项”“高级”页“浏览”栏下的“启用第三方浏览器扩展(需重启)”前的复选框来禁用第三方控件或者进入“Internet选项”“常规”页面,单击“Internet 临时文件”中的“设置”,再单击“查看对象”来打开“Downloaded Program Files”文件夹,在其中的控件文件上点鼠标右键并选择“删除”来将第三方控件删除掉。当然,您也可以使用工具来完成禁用和删除第三方控件的操作,例如:upiea(不限于这一种)
upiea 下载地址:http://www.lumix.cn/upiea/
相关信息您可以参考以下知识库文章:
如何禁用第三方工具带区和浏览器帮助对象 http://support.microsoft.com/kb/298931/zh-cn
如何在 Windows 中删除 ActiveX 控件 http://support.microsoft.com/kb/154850/zh-cn
如何在 Windows XP Service Pack 2 中管理 Internet Explorer 附件 http://support.microsoft.com/?scid=kb;zh-cn;883256
了解和排除 Internet Explorer 中不可恢复的错误(故障) http://support.microsoft.com/?sc … pid=807&sid=186
如何重新安装或修复 Windows XP 中的 Internet Explorer 和 Outlook Express http://support.microsoft.com/default.aspx?scid=kb;zh-cn;318378 http://bbs.mscommunity.com/forums/ShowThread.aspx?PostID=5852
关于IE脚本错误的问题
一般来说,IE 出现脚本错误的原因大概有以下几种:
– 网页的 HTML 源代码中有问题。 – 您的计算机或网络上阻止了活动脚本、ActiveX 控件或 Java 小程序。Internet Explorer 或另外一种程序(如防病毒程序或防火墙)可以配置为阻止活动脚本、ActiveX 控件或 Java 小程序。 – 防病毒软件配置为扫描您的“临时 Internet 文件”或“已下载的程序文件”文件夹。 – 您计算机上的脚本引擎损坏或过时。 – 您计算机上的 Internet 相关文件夹损坏。 – 您的视频卡驱动程序已损坏或者已过时。 – 您计算机上的 DirectX 组件损坏或过时。
关于如何排除Internet Explorer中的脚本错误,您可以参考这篇知识库文章: http://support.microsoft.com/kb/308260/zh-cn
您也可以尝试安装最新版本的JAVA程序安装来尝试解决脚本错误
下载地址:http://www.java.com/zh_CN/
微软 WINDOWS SCRIPCHS 5.6
下载地址:http://download.microsoft.com/do … ee128e/scripchs.exe
推荐几款除错工具
如果您具备一定的动手能力和系统知识,那么也可以尝试一下以下几种常用的 Windows/Internet Explorer 除错工具:
1、[Process Explorer]
下载地址:http://www.sysinternals.com/Utilities/ProcessExplorer.html
2、[Registry Monitor]
下载地址:http://www.sysinternals.com/utilities/regmon.html
3、[File Monitor]
下载地址:http://www.sysinternals.com/Utilities/Filemon.html
4、[TDIMon]
下载地址:http://www.sysinternals.com/utilities/tdimon.html
5、[Advanced Registry Tracer]
下载地址:http://www.elcomsoft.com/art.html
6、Microsoft Product Support’s Reporting Tools(Microsoft 配置捕获实用工具)
下载地址:http://www.microsoft.com/downloa … &displaylang=en
相关信息: Microsoft 配置捕获实用工具(MPS_REPORTS)概述: http://support.microsoft.com/kb/818742
最后,想提醒各位 IE 用户,当您在使用 IE 的过程中遇到问题时,可以先使用关键字在微软的官方知识库(KB)中查找解决方案
如何使用关键字和查询词查询 Microsoft 知识库: http://support.microsoft.com/?scid=kb;zh-cn;242450
Microsoft Internet Explorer 产品支持中心页面: http://support.microsoft.com/ph/807
以上转自“微软新闻组,Internet Explorer 中文讨论区” 以下为正树新添加的内容:
Steven Li 的写的许多内容基本多是基于一种“亡羊补牢”的措施,但是很多时候都是防不胜防。 我个人认为,就像是人一样,就算是有再好的药,也宁愿保持健康不生病。
所以还应该学会如何让 Internet Explorer 保持在健康的状态,这点可以说是不是怎么在排错状态了。 首先简单说来,就应该让系统能够健康。我记得在 04、05 年的时候在微软的家庭安全网站上有“安全三步曲”的指导的样子,现在一时找不到了。简单说来就是:1、安装使用最新版的杀毒软件且应当最少一周更新一新病毒库;2、安装、配置最新的系统更新;3、安装并正确配置防火墙。具体的可以登陆微软“家庭安全”网站查看:
微软家庭安全网站(中文): http://www.microsoft.com/china/athome/security/default.mspx
然后最好是安装且使用反间谍软件,一般我个人不建议使用同类的工具式的软件。可以使用如 Windows Defender Beta 2、Ad-Aware 之类的。这类软件一般都具有登陆系统后自动加载,且会提示或发出警告有多长时间没有进行过扫描了。
做好了以上 4 点,其实还有最重要的一点,就是电脑使用者的因素:如不访问一些可能存在危险的不明站点、不安装或使用一些可能存在小工具等等。换句话说就是洁身之好。(说句开玩笑的话,如果所有的电脑使用者都能做到这些的话,那么许多电脑技术员的饭碗应该要重新考虑别家饭的问题了)
然后,再对于 Internet Explorer 6 Service Pack 2 以及以上版本的“管理加载项”的问题对 Steven Li 的文章做一些补充说明吧。
在 IE6SP2 中的管理加载项中可以管理所有加载项的使用情况。先介绍一个实例
像今天我就碰到一位,IE 就是 IE6SP2 的。他说他一打开 IE 窗口就会报出应用程序错误。不错,就诚如 Steven Li 所说的那样,Internet Explorer 自身并不太可能出现问题。所以我也是通过一位网友的中转进行远程协助帮忙解决问题的。 在他的加载项中有一项叫做“accoona”的未验证的工具栏加载项,虽然他其他还有两个启用的加载项分别是:MSN 工具栏和 FlashGet Bar。FlashGet Bar 当然也是未验证状态的,但是使用这个工具栏基本没出现过有问题的情况。像这种情况,首先就是要先禁用未知的未验证的加载项,如工具栏、ActiveX 控件、浏览器帮助程序对象等。通过排查法进行禁用一个一个不明,甚至于知道来源、知道用途的加载项。在禁用了上面说的那个工具栏之后,再打开 Internet Explorer,问题解决。像这个个例其实还是比较简单的。 但是,如果发生所有的加载项都在禁用后,仍然出现 Internet Explorer 程序出错的话,那么就有可能是注册表、或者文件损坏。而出现这种情况就有可能是感染病毒所造成的,这时应当使用最新病毒库的大型安全软件公司推出的杀毒软件进行查毒。
另外,像“管理加载项”的这类功能有时候也很有用,一个可以比如禁用在安装完某些软件时加入的一些虽然是善意的加载项工具,但是可能自己不想去使用时,也可以通过这样的方法去禁用。